Indonesia's Military Produces Multivitamins Amid Food Poisoning Crisis
10/2/2025
50 6
1 of 1
Story summary
- Indonesian military began producing multivitamins for children as part of a free meals program, announced October 1, 2025.
- President Prabowo Subianto has expanded military roles into civilian sectors since 2024.
- Critics warn this could revive Suharto-era military dominance, and the free meals program faced food poisoning sickening 9,089 children.
- The government says the move strengthens national defense.
